Perhaps it's the people. But in the case of Buddhism, if everyone followed it's teachings to a T, they wouldn't exist after one generation. They wouldn't have children. They wouldn't prolong this Life/Death/Rebirth cycle of suffering. The persistence of Buddhism requires that it's followers not follow it consistently.

In the case of Protestantism, the supposed work ethic comes from the notion that material success is evidence of living properly in Gods eyes. This contradicts other Christian teachings.
